Buying advice for a classic bike
Design and Aesthetics
Classic bicycles embody timeless elegance and well-thought-out design. Their frames are often made from high-quality materials, providing robustness and durability. Many models stand out with details such as handcrafted paintwork, chrome elements, and traditional frame shapes. Leather saddles and stylish handlebar tape give these bikes their distinctive charm, making them real eye-catchers.
Classic bicycle types
Classic bicycles are versatile and adapted to different uses:
City bikes: Practical and comfortable for urban commuting, featuring an upright riding position and useful additions like luggage racks and fenders.
Trekking bikes: Suitable for long tours and various terrains, equipped with sturdy frames and luggage options.
Cruiser bikes With wide tires and a relaxed geometry, perfect for leisurely rides in the city or along the beach.
Dutch bikes: Classic models with an upright seating position and functional accessories, ideal for flat terrain and everyday use.
Folding bikes: Compact and easy to transport, perfect for commuters or limited storage spaces.Materials and Workmanship
The materials of classic bicycles are as diverse as their applications. Frames can be made of steel, aluminum, or other high-quality materials. They provide stability and durability without sacrificing style. Precise welds and carefully crafted components emphasize their high quality. Leather is often used for saddles and grips, as it offers comfort and adapts individually to the rider.
Technical Features
Classic bicycles combine time-tested design with modern technology. Many models feature reliable gear systems and high-quality brakes that ensure safety and precision. Despite their retro appearance, they often include practical features that enhance riding comfort, such as ergonomic grips or durable wheels.
Customization Options
Another advantage of classic bicycles is the ability to customize them. From the saddle to the paintwork, owners can tailor their bike to their personal preferences. This flexibility makes classic bicycles unique companions that are not only functional but also stylish.
